In this edition, we explore the cutting-edge technologies transforming the design, operation, and maintenance of substations, which are the backbone of our electrical transmission and distribution systems. As the demand for reliable, efficient, and resilient power continues to grow, the evolution of substation technologies is essential to meet the challenges of modern energy grids.

This special issue delves into the latest advancements in substation automation, smart grid integration, protection systems, and asset management. We explore how digitalization, real-time monitoring, and predictive maintenance are helping to optimize substation performance, enhance safety, and reduce operational costs. With increasing reliance on renewable energy sources and a push for sustainability, substations must evolve to support the integration of decentralized power generation and ensure grid stability.

Through expert insights, case studies, and industry trends, this edition offers a comprehensive look at how new technologies are reshaping the future of substations. Whether you're an engineer, utility professional, or industry leader, you'll find valuable information on the innovations driving the transformation of substations and how they play a crucial role in building smarter, more resilient power networks.
